What this charge usually means

The descriptor JCPENNEY PAY MY is most commonly tied to a payment activity connected to a JCPenney credit account serviced by Synchrony, rather than a new retail purchase at checkout. In plain terms, it often appears when a cardholder makes a bill payment, schedules an online payment, or has an account-related transaction post with a short descriptor format. Descriptors are abbreviated by banks, so the text you see is often shorter than the brand name or webpage you used.

If you recently logged into the JCPenney credit card portal, made a guest payment, or paid by phone, this descriptor can be expected. It may also appear if an authorized user on your account made or scheduled payment activity. Timing differences are normal: the transaction date on your bank statement can differ from the date you initiated the action.

Why it appeared on your statement

  • You submitted a one-time payment for a JCPenney card balance.
  • An auto-scheduled payment posted around your due date.
  • A prior pending payment finally settled and displayed with a shortened descriptor.
  • An authorized user handled account payment activity.
  • Your bank compressed merchant text into a brief statement label.

If you were expecting a store purchase descriptor and instead see this phrase, that usually indicates account servicing or payment handling text, not a separate merchandise order.

How to verify the charge quickly

Start by checking your JCPenney/Synchrony account payment history for the same amount and date. Then compare it with your checking account ledger. If the amount matches a payment you initiated, the charge is likely legitimate. Keep screenshots of confirmation numbers and timestamps in case you need to discuss the posting with support.

How to cancel or stop future occurrences

Because this is usually payment-related, you do not "cancel" the descriptor itself. Instead, cancel or edit the underlying payment setup. Log in to the account center and review recurring or scheduled payments. Turn off autopay if you do not want automatic drafts, and confirm the change was saved. If a payment is still pending, contact support immediately to check whether it can be modified before final processing.

For account safety, update your password, enable alerts, and verify your contact details if you suspect someone else accessed your profile.

How to dispute if it looks wrong

If you do not recognize the amount, call the merchant/card servicer first and ask for a payment trace by date and amount. If they cannot validate it, contact your card issuer or bank and file a dispute. Request provisional credit when available and provide evidence: statement screenshot, account history, and any merchant emails.

Act quickly. Dispute windows are time-limited by card-network rules and your bank policy. Ask the issuer to block repeat attempts if you suspect unauthorized account access. In many cases, the fastest path is: merchant verification first, then issuer dispute with documentation.

Why does the descriptor differ from the merchant name?
Banks often shorten or reformat merchant data for statement lines, so the descriptor may show abbreviated text like JCPENNEY PAY MY instead of a full business name.
